          簡單的商務(wù)英語口語四

          A: do you like Barry?

          B: no, not very much. He’s too ambitious and dishonest.

          A: I agree. I like his brother, Paul. They are not alike.

          B: yes. They are completely different. Paul is very sociable and much more honest than his brother.

          A: what kind of person do you consider yourself to be?

          B: I think I’m polite, careful, relaxed and shy.

          A: oh, I don’t think you’re shy! You are always chatting with new people when we go to a party.

          B: well, yes, but those people always start talking to me. I never talk to them first. Perhaps I’m not as shy as I think. Anyway, you’re certainly not shy!

          A: You’re right. I love going out and making new friends.

          B: so, you’ll be at my birthday party on Friday?

          A: Of course!

          Intermediate

          A: How do you think people get their personalities?

          B: I think it’s mainly from the environment a person lives it.

          A: Don’t you think people get their personalities from their parents?

          B: no, but parents control a lot of the environment that kids grow up in, so they certainly influence their kid’s personalities a lot.

          A: So why do you think many kids have personalities that are so different to their parents.

          B: maybe when they become teenagers, they want to be completely different to their parents.

          A: You might be right. I guess most parents want their kids to be like them, but kids today grow up in a different environment. You know, they know much more about the world from the internet, newspapers, and tv.

          B: do you think that teenagers get a lot of their bad behaviour from tv and movies?

          A: Maybe some of it. I think a lot of people blame TV and movies when the real problem is that the parents aren’t bringing their child up correctly.

          B: Parents have a difficult job. They have to bring up their children and usually have to work too.

          A: Yes, that’s fine. Your son is doing well at school, isn’t he?

          B: yes, he is. He’s very hardworking when he’s at school. Then he comes home from school and does homework before dinner. After dinner, he goes out with his friends.

          A: So, he’s not a bookworm? It’s good that he has an outgoing personality. Some kids are very quiet and introverted. You wonder they’ll survive in the real world without their parents to support them.
